How to File a Mesothelioma Lawsuit

Although each case of mesothelioma is unique, there are some common steps. An experienced attorney will handle all the legal details so you can concentrate on treatment.

Experienced lawyers know where to locate important evidence, including medical and employment records. Lawyers have access to databases that list asbestos manufacturers, their locations of operation and the products they manufactured.

Compensation

A successful mesothelioma case could result in a significant financial award. Compensation is based on various factors, including medical costs and loss of income. Each case is unique and a lawyer's experience can play a significant role in the amount awarded.

Mesothelioma patients may be compensated through a lawsuit or trust fund, as well as other avenues. The best method to determine which is best for you is to speak with an experienced mesothelioma lawyer.

Your lawyer will evaluate your case and recommend the best course of action to pursue compensation. This could involve filing a mesothelioma lawsuit, a claim against the mesothelioma fund, or any other type of asbestos-related claim.

Typically, mesothelioma lawsuits are settled in a non-judicial manner. This can save time and money for both parties, since the court process can take years to be completed.

Settlement amounts can be higher than the verdict of a jury. The amount that is awarded depends on the ability of the defendant to pay. If the defendant has a large company with many resources this is a greater chance to offer a higher settlement.

If the defendants are unable to settle the case, a jury will review your mesothelioma lawsuit and decide on the amount you are due. The jury listens to the testimony, looks at evidence and considers arguments from your lawyer and the defendants before coming to a decision.

If your mesothelioma lawsuit includes compensatory damages for your loss of income or emotional distress, these payouts are not tax-deductible. If punitive damages are included in your verdict or settlement you could be taxed under federal law. Damages

A mesothelioma lawsuit that is successful can result in compensation for victims and their families. While no amount of money will compensate for a victim's illness, it can help secure financial security for the future.

In the United States, victims can get compensation for medical bills as well as funeral expenses, lost wages and other non-economic damages like suffering and pain. A qualified asbestos lawyer can explain your legal rights and assist you in filing an action to receive the compensation that you deserve.

Mesothelioma patients can seek compensatory and punitive damages from the responsible companies. Compensation for medical expenses and lost wages may help pay for living expenses. Punitive damages are awarded when the defendant acted with malice or showed an inconsiderate disregard for employee safety.

Usually, mesothelioma settlements can be negotiated prior to the case is brought to trial. A jury trial could be requested by victims to get a better compensation. A mesothelioma lawyer can help determine if it is in the best interest of their client.

Most mesothelioma lawyers practice on a contingency basis. This means they do not charge upfront fees to clients, but instead receive a portion of the final settlement or verdict. This arrangement allows families to concentrate on treatment and ensuring an income that is stable while the lawyer makes sure their client gets the maximum amount of money possible.

Bankrupt asbestos companies have set aside millions of dollars in trust funds to compensate victims and their loved ones. In many cases, mesothelioma lawyers are able to successfully bring claims against these asbestos trusts in order to help you and your family receive compensation.

Discovery

A lot of people who are diagnosed with pleural mesothelioma must rely on compensation to help pay for treatment expenses. A successful lawsuit will also help alleviate the financial burden of their loved ones and provide patients with peace of mind.

The first step in mesothelioma cases is to determine who is accountable for the asbestos exposure which caused the disease. This involves researching the victim’s asbestos exposure history and finding any companies that could be liable. BCBH Law's lawyers BCBH Law will compile all of this information and use it to submit an action on their client's behalf.

During the discovery phase, mesothelioma sufferers may request information from defendants and conduct depositions to obtain evidence to support their claims. The number of possible at-fault parties in a mesothelioma lawsuit will determine how long this part of the lawsuit will take. For instance the construction worker who has had years of asbestos exposure will have more potential at-fault parties than a medical professional who worked in an asbestos-ridden building for only a few months.

Mesothelioma lawsuits are typically filed as individual claims, not class action lawsuits. This is because the U.S. Supreme Court has declared it unfair to lump future and current victims in a class because of their different exposure histories and diseases.

Most mesothelioma lawsuits are settled before they are brought to the courtroom. If a lawsuit is brought to trial, both lawyers representing the plaintiff and defense will present their case before a jury or judge.

Settlements

A mesothelioma settlement can help victims and their families pay for medical expenses, lost wages, and other costs. Asbestos victims also get compensation for suffering and pain. Additionally, mesothelioma sufferers and their loved ones could qualify for VA benefits as well as asbestos trust fund compensation.

A mesothelioma lawyer for the victim will gather evidence to show that asbestos companies are responsible for the asbestos-related illness. They will interview former workers and gather documents, as well as examine medical records. They will also conduct a thorough investigation into asbestos exposure and the health condition caused by asbestos.

The lawyer for the plaintiff will negotiate a settlement with the defendants. This can happen prior to or during the trial. Defendants will agree to settle for a lower cost of legal fees and negative publicity. a lengthy proceeding.

Most mesothelioma lawsuits end with an agreement. A mesothelioma survivor or their family can start receiving payments within 90 days after filing a lawsuit.

Mesothelioma lawyers are paid on a contingency basis. They do not charge any upfront fees, and only collect their fee after the case is concluded and a verdict has been reached.

The amount of mesothelioma-related compensation that is granted in an agreement or trial verdict will depend on the specific circumstances of each case. Asbestos victims could be able to take a portion of their compensation in filing state and federal taxes. A mesothelioma lawyer or tax advisor will be able to explain the tax laws for each situation. Since the families of the victims sign confidentiality agreements, the amount of mesothelioma-related compensation remains private. Certain settlement figures are made public, like the $24 million verdict handed out to a pleural mesothelioma patient in July of 2018. This case was against Ford Motor Company.

Trial

If a mesothelioma patient passes away the family members of the victim can file a wrongful death lawsuit to seek compensation. This type of lawsuit could help their loved ones to pay for funeral costs, medical bills, and lost income. A mesothelioma suit can also compensate victims for their suffering, pain and loss of income.

A wrongful death suit could be a way to seek punitive damages. These are awarded for a company's negligence which includes placing profits over safety and putting lives of others in danger. These claims are usually bigger than personal injury claims.

Mesothelioma lawyers can negotiate a settlement with the defendants in your case. This is a viable option for many patients because it's often the quickest method of obtaining financial compensation. A reputable lawyer will ensure that you receive the compensation you deserve and will not be satisfied with less.

If a settlement isn't feasible, mesothelioma lawyers will take your case to trial. A jury will listen to testimony, scrutinize evidence and scrutinize arguments made by your attorney and defense team. The jury will then decide on a verdict.
